ADA - Edwin Murphy, 67, of 802 E. North died 1 p.m. Monday in Lima Memorial Hospital.
Born in Francesville, Ind., Dec. 31, 1902, he was the son of Thomas and Frances Lucas Murphy. He married Frances Haynes in 1934 and she survives.
Also surviving are a son, John of Rt. 2; a sister, Mrs. Hazel Lyons of Caledonia; five brothers, Lee of Harpster, Arthur of Payne, and Cecil, Morral and Clifford, all of Caledonia; and three grandchildren.
Services will be 2 p.m. Thursday in Hanson Funeral Home, Rev. Willard Thomas officiating. Burial will be in Woodlawn Cemetery. Friends may call at the funeral home 7-9 tonight and 2-4 and 7-9 p.m. Wednesday.
(published in The Lima News, Tuesday, June 23, 1970)
